FTAI Aviation Conference Call Summary Company Overview - **Company**: FTAI Aviation - **Industry**: Aviation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ul (MRO) and Engine Leasing - **Core Business**: Outsourced engine maintenance primarily for CFM 56 and V2500 engines, which are widely used in commercial aircraft fleets [4][5] Key Points and Arguments Business Model and Strategy - FTAI Aviation focuses on acquiring, rebuilding, and leasing engines, providing flexibility and cost savings to airlines and lessors [4][5] - The company aims to capture approximately 25% market share in the engine maintenance sector, with a current annual maintenance spend of $22 billion for the targeted engines [5][6] - A strategic capital initiative (SCI) was launched to own and manage a portfolio of aircraft, enhancing visibility and efficiency in engine maintenance [6][11] Financial Performance and Projections - FTAI generated approximately $1 billion in revenue from engine maintenance, representing under 5% of the total market spend [5] - The company expects to achieve $250 million in EBITDA from the new partnership under the SCI, with a target of $4 billion investment to own about 250 aircraft [12][11] - For 2025, FTAI projects $650 million in EBITDA from aerospace products and $500 million from leasing [52][56] Market Dynamics - The aviation maintenance market is expected to maintain a stable annual spend of $22 billion through 2030, despite potential declines in engine values due to new aircraft deliveries [63][64] - FTAI's business model allows it to optimize maintenance costs and turnaround times, providing a competitive edge over traditional MRO providers [19][24] Customer Response and Adoption - FTAI has over 100 customers, with high levels of repeat usage and positive feedback regarding cost savings and efficiency [26][27] - The company emphasizes the importance of engine availability and maintenance control, which differentiates it from traditional lessors [75] Capacity and Investment - FTAI has physical capacity for approximately 600 shop visits annually, with ongoing investments in facilities and parts inventory to support growth [29][30] - The company plans to ramp up operations in Montreal and Rome, adding significant capacity to meet future demand [30] Risks and Challenges - Concerns exist regarding potential margin compression if asset values decline, but FTAI believes its model is resilient due to the self-correcting nature of the engine market [32][34] - The company faces competition from third-party MROs, but its unique combination of asset ownership and maintenance capabilities provides a significant advantage [36][39] Future Outlook - FTAI plans to invest in next-generation engines starting in 2028-2029, ensuring long-term growth and sustainability [57] - The company is committed to maintaining a fleet of 450-500 CFM 56 engines and 50-200 V2500 engines to ensure engine availability for customers [76] Additional Important Information - FTAI's partnership with AAR for used serviceable material allows for optimized parts distribution without building a separate parts business [61] - The company has a joint venture with Chrome Moy for PMA parts, which is expected to enhance margins significantly once fully operational [59][60] This summary encapsulates the key insights from the FTAI Aviation conference call, highlighting the company's strategic direction, financial outlook, and market positioning within the aviation industry.

Financial Performance - For the three months ended March 31, 2025, total revenues increased to $502.1 million, up 53.7% from $326.7 million in the same period of 2024 [150]. - The company reported a net income of $102.4 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025, compared to $39.6 million in 2024, representing a growth of 158.3% [150]. - Adjusted EBITDA for the three months ended March 31, 2025, was $268.6 million, an increase of 63.7% from $164.1 million in 2024 [152]. - Net income increased by $62.8 million, primarily due to the revenue growth and changes in expenses [155]. - Adjusted EBITDA increased by $104.5 million, reflecting improved operational performance [156]. - Net income attributable to shareholders increased by $40.2 million, reaching $106.6 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025, compared to $66.4 million in 2024 [170]. - Adjusted EBITDA (non-GAAP) increased by $60.7 million to $130.9 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025, compared to $70.3 million in 2024 [174]. Revenue Breakdown - Aerospace products revenue for the same period was $365.1 million, a significant increase of 93.1% compared to $189.1 million in 2024 [150]. - Total revenues increased by $175.4 million, driven by a $176.0 million increase in Aerospace products revenue and a $15.2 million increase in lease income [153]. - Lease income for the three months ended March 31, 2025, was $68.5 million, an increase of 28.6% from $53.2 million in 2024 [150]. - Maintenance revenue increased by $3.8 million, driven by more aircraft and engines on lease [164]. - Aerospace products revenue increased by $176.0 million to $365.1 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025, compared to $189.1 million in the same period of 2024 [171]. Expenses and Financial Obligations - Total expenses increased by $117.4 million, with cost of sales rising by $105.9 million [153]. - Interest expense increased by $14.3 million, reflecting a rise in average debt outstanding to approximately $955.7 million [158]. - The provision for income taxes increased by $17.3 million, driven by higher income from Aircraft Leasing and Aerospace Products segments [154]. - Total expenses rose by $119.6 million, with cost of sales increasing by $117.8 million, primarily due to higher sales of CFM56-5B, CFM56-7B, and V2500 engines [175]. - The provision for income taxes increased by $16.8 million, primarily due to higher income from Aerospace Products activities [172]. - As of March 31, 2025, the company had outstanding principal and interest payment obligations of $3.7 billion and $1.4 billion, respectively, with only $248.9 million in interest payments due in the next twelve months [191]. Strategic Initiatives - The company launched a Strategic Capital Initiative on December 30, 2024, focusing on acquiring 737NG and A320ceo aircraft in partnership with institutional investors [144]. - The company expects to manage aircraft for and make minority investments in future partnerships under the Strategic Capital Initiative [144]. - The company launched a Strategic Capital Initiative to acquire 737NG and A320ceo aircraft, focusing on maintaining an asset-light business model [182]. Cash Flow and Investments - Cash used for investments was $339.4 million for the three months ended March 31, 2025, compared to $303.0 million in 2024 [185]. - Net cash used in operating activities increased by $25.6 million to $(25,966) thousand in Q1 2025, primarily due to changes in net working capital of $132.8 million and an increase in gain on insurance recoveries of $30.1 million [188]. - Net cash used in investing activities decreased by $141.6 million to $(27,627) thousand in Q1 2025, driven by proceeds from the sale of assets of $104.6 million and a return of deposits for acquisition of leasing equipment of $43.8 million [189]. - Net cash provided by financing activities decreased by $93.4 million to $50,610 thousand in Q1 2025, mainly due to redemption of preferred shares of $124.2 million and repayment of debt of $55.0 million [190]. - Proceeds from the sale of assets were $263.1 million in Q1 2025, up from $128.4 million in Q1 2024 [194]. Impairments and Losses - The company recognized an impairment charge of $120.0 million for leasing equipment assets related to the impact of Russia's invasion of Ukraine [140]. - Net loss attributable to shareholders in the Corporate and Other segment increased by $9.0 million, reaching $(86.8) million for the three months ended March 31, 2025 [176]. Interest Rate Sensitivity - A hypothetical 100-basis point increase in variable interest rates would result in an increase of approximately $2.0 million in interest expense over the next 12 months [202].

For the quarter ended March 2025, FTAI Aviation (FTAI) reported revenue of $502.08 million, up 53.7% over the same period last year. EPS came in at $0.87, compared to $0.31 in the year-ago quarter.The reported revenue represents a surprise of -5.94% over the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$533.8 million.
